Subject: Re: [PATCH] ata: sata_highbank: fix OF node reference leak in highbank_initialize_phys()

On Tue, Dec 17, 2024 at 12:15:35PM +0100, Krzysztof Kozlowski wrote:
> On 09/12/2024 01:14, Damien Le Moal wrote:
> > On 12/5/24 19:30, Joe Hattori wrote:
> >> The OF node reference obtained by of_parse_phandle_with_args() is not
> >> released on early return. Add a of_node_put() call before returning.
> >>
> >> Fixes: 8996b89d6bc9 ("ata: add platform driver for Calxeda AHCI controller")
> >> Signed-off-by: Joe Hattori <joe@pf.is.s.u-tokyo.ac.jp>
> >
> > Applied to for-6.13-fixes. Thanks !
> Considering that:
> 1. Few other fixes reported by this static analysis were bogus and never
> tested,
> 2. Missing of_node_put is entirely harmless, absolutely 0 effect, no
> leak of anything, nothing to worry, no-op code currently,
> 3. But a mistakenly added incorrect of_node_put is a use-after-free bug,
> 4. This was in the kernel for long time, like 12 years (!!!),
>
> then I really do not understand how it could be a 6.13-current-rc-fixes
> material.
>
> That's just wrong and possibly causing more harm. Really, please stop
> sending trivial static analyzer fixes for 12 year old bug to current RC.
>
> This was brought several times, last quote:
>
> "I'm definitely not reverting a patch from almost a decade ago as a
> regression.
> If it took that long to find, it can't be that critical of a regression.
> So yes, let's treat it as a regular bug."
